ⅰceЪаΒŸ ʕ ᵔᴥᵔ ʔA Nostalgic Journey to Old Shanghai at the Yangtze Hotel
The Yangtze Hotel, a century-old establishment, embodies the charm of old Shanghai. Built in 1933, it was once known as the 'third largest hotel in the Far East.' Though now rebranded as The Yangtze Boutique Hotel, for me, the name 'Yangtze Hotel' evokes a more elegant and romantic feel, befitting a high-end, historically preserved building.
Stepping into the hotel lobby, the romantic ambiance of old Shanghai washes over you, as if traveling back in time. It makes you want to hum the tune of 'Rose, Rose, I Love You,' a song that has resonated here through the ages, becoming an eternal classic. After checking in, exploring, and taking photos, I recommend heading to the Western restaurant on the first floor for afternoon tea. The Western pastries are beautifully presented, with a wide variety of sweet options and fewer savory ones. The taste was just average, but the service was excellent. Coming here is more about soaking in the atmosphere and enjoying the sentiment that the environment and service evoke.

Guest UserI stayed for two nights and was very satisfied with the hotel. The facilities were complete and well-equipped, including a smart toilet and a mini-fridge. The toiletries were good, and there were full-length, vanity, and makeup mirrors. I especially liked the thoughtful shower design: a large overhead rainfall shower for adults and a lower wall-mounted one for children. The bed was also very comfortable. The hotel's location is excellent, just about 50-60 meters to the right of Exit 2 of Dashijie Station on Line 8. It's close to Nanjing Road Pedestrian Street and The Bund, and only a stop or two away by subway. The male receptionist was polite and had a great attitude, and the cleaning staff were also very friendly and polite, always greeting everyone with a smile. Overall, it was a fantastic experience!

wangying_0418The European Baroque style is grand, and even the basic rooms are spacious at over 70 sqm, featuring a 2.2-meter king-size bed, a balcony, and a well-designed layout that makes for a very comfortable stay. The service is warm and friendly, breakfast and the buffet are plentiful, and the pool is beautiful. It's suitable for both families with children and business travelers. The downsides are that some facilities are a bit dated since the hotel has been open for several years, the location is a bit out in the suburbs and far from the subway, a few rooms occasionally have some minor cleaning issues in corners, and the underground parking entrance is a bit narrow.

This appears to be an older hotel though maintenance was done to keep things running and clean. It is in a good location in the city for our planned activities. There was ease of access and I liked that the facility had laundry self service available on site 24 hours per day. The laundry access was the most important because I traveled light and I went in August when it was the hottest and most humid time in Shanghai. Staff were professional and greeter at the door helped with opening and closing car doors and getting luggage out of car. Hotel lobby was well lit and spacious and comfortable. My parents with my sisters got a room with a broken bathroom door and non-working phone. Once staff were informed, they were quick to move them to a different room. Unfortunately I did not have enough time to fully explore the hotel and utilize the gym and swimming pool.
The hotel room I had was comfortable with everything working. It was well lit and the AC system functioned very well.
The only thing I did not like was the smoke smell in the hallways.
Smoking cigarettes is a huge problem in China and of course the hotel has no control over this. However they can implement better air filtration and cleaning systems as many travelers may be asthmatic or have strong allergic sensitivity to the smoke particles.
